Job description

Project Manager II
Location: Remote Eligible - must reside within service territories (DE, PA, MD, NC, FL, GA, OH, VA)

Your role in our success will be:

This position carries the responsibility for planning, directing, and coordinating various projects valued between $10M-40M associated with gas distribution and transmission. Organizes multi-disciplinary teams through project lifecycles consisting of project creation, budgeting, monitoring, and making adjustments when required.

What you'll be working on:

  • Leads and manages project management team; accountable for planning, coordinating, directing and monitoring progress of projects scopes of $10MM - $40MM.
  • Monitor progress of project to ensure alignment with established goals and budgets while making adjustments to timelines and resources as necessary.
  • Update budgets, forecasts, schedules (Gantt Charts), and status reports on a regular basis showing milestones according to original plan.
  • Ensures compliance of project and outcome that meets all required safety regulations and requirements of Chesapeake Utilities as well as the Pipeline Health and Safety Administration, OSHA, and other Federal and State requirements.
  • Creates project status presentations consisting of budget forecasts, timelines, and milestones, to business unit leaders on a monthly basis.
  • Assist with selection, review of contractor progress.
  • Responsible for exhibiting Chesapeake Utilities Corporation’s Mission, Vision and Values, regarding external customers, agencies, vendors, internal departments and coworkers.

Who you are:

  • Education: Bachelor’s Degree in Technical Field (Project Management, Engineering, Construction).
  • Work Experience: 3 years Project Management or Engineering.
  • Drivers’ License (type): Drivers license.
  • Licensure/Certification: PMP Certification or ability to obtain within 6 months.
